We have chosen St. John Paul II and St. Gianna Beretta Molla as our official patron saints. These two saints protected the sanctity of life and fought against the dehumanization of abortion during their lives here on earth and continue to do so as saints in heaven. This is why we petition for their prayers as we fight to protect the sanctity of life. Join us in prayer.

Prayer is our best weapon. Will you join us?

We cannot win the battle against a culture of death without the help of prayer.

Will you commit to praying for the safety of the defenseless today? Your prayers make a difference, your prayers can save a life.

Specifically, please pray for:

  • The unborn child’s life that may or will be taken today.
  • The mother of an aborted child. Whether she mourns the loss of her child or still believes what she did was right, pray God will give her healing and she will find peace and forgiveness.
  • The mother who is contemplating abortion; that she will chose life for her child.
  • The disabled child that is at risk of abortion.
  • The elderly or handicap at risk of euthanasia.
  • For young men and women that they will respect their bodies and the bodies of others.
  • For men who are victims of abortion. May God heal their hearts as they mourn the loss of their child.
  • Our leaders, may they protect life at all stages.
  • Our Legislators, that they work to protect life from fertilization to natural death.
  • For the Abortionists, nurses, and those who work for or with the abortion industry. May their hearts soften and minds open to the lives being violently ended everyday.
